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I):
• If you have a pacemaker, metallic implant, previous brain surgery, or have had metal fragments in your eyes, or known allergies to Gadolinium; please call CBCC prior to appointment time.
• Creatinine/BUN required for MRI within 45 days if 60 or older, renal insufficient, diabetic or hypertensive.
• No preparation is required unless sedation is needed.

PET/CT:
• Do not eat or drink anything for 6-12 hours prior to your exam,
except water.
• Avoid strenuous activity 24 hours in advance of your study.
ULTRASOUND
Abdomen Ultrasound:
• Nothing to eat, drink or smoke after midnight.
• No breakfast, smoking or gum chewing the morning of exam.
OB and Pelvic Ultrasound:
• 1/2 hours before exam time, empty your bladder and drink
32 oz. of water, finishing 1 hour prior to exam.
• Arrive with a very full bladder. Do not urinate.
• Pelvic ultrasound should not be scheduled during menstruation.
Prostate Ultrasound:
• Fleet´s enema 1/2 hour prior to exam.
Upper GI and/or Esophogram and/or Small Bowel Series:
• Nothing to eat, drink or smoke after midnight.
• For small-bowel series, allow at least 4 hours for exam.
